近年来,Web3作为互联网的下一个演进方向,承载着人们对去中心化、用户主权和数据自由的美好憧憬,从区块链的分布式账本到智能合约的自动执行,再到NFT的独特性证明,Web3技术正试图重塑数字世界的规则,在这股创新浪潮之下,一个基础却致命的问题日益凸显,成为制约Web3大规模普及的“阿喀琉斯之踵”——连接不稳定。
这种连接不稳定并非单指网络信号不佳,而是涵盖了Web3生态中多个层面的连接脆弱性,它像一层迷雾,笼罩在用户体验、开发者热情和行业发展的道路上。
用户体验的“断崖”:从兴奋到挫败的瞬间
对于普通用户而言,Web3的连接不稳定最直观的体现就是交互过程中的频繁卡顿、延迟甚至失败,想象一下,当用户兴致勃勃地准备参与一个热门NFT的铸造,却在提交交易的瞬间因网络拥堵导致交易失败;当用户急需一笔资金转账,却因节点响应缓慢而长时间等待;当用户在使用一个去中心化应用(DApp)时,页面加载缓慢,甚至出现“无法连接到节点”的提示,这些场景,在Web3世界中屡见不鲜。
与Web2时代即时响应的体验相比,这种不稳定性极大地消耗了用户的耐心和信任,用户需要面对的不仅仅是互联网连接本身,还有对节点性能、网络拥堵、Gas费波动等一系列不可控因素的担忧,这种“不确定性”使得Web3应用的门槛陡然升高,许多潜在用户在初步尝试后就因糟糕的体验而望而却步,严重阻碍了用户群体的扩大和生态的繁荣。
开发者的“枷锁”:创新路上的无形障碍
Web3的开发者们同样深受连接不稳定的困扰,构建一个稳定、流畅的DApp,需要开发者不仅要关注智能合约的逻辑正确性,还要在底层架构上投入大量精力去应对连接问题。
- 节点选择的难题:开发者需要选择可靠且高效的节点服务,但自建节点成本高昂,使用公共节点则可能面临性能不一、不稳定甚至被攻击的风险,节点的不稳定直接导致应用后端响应不可靠,影响用户体验。
- 网络拥堵的“硬伤”:在以太坊等主流公网拥堵时,交易确认缓慢、Gas费飙升成为常态,开发者难以预测交易成本,也无法保证用户操作的及时性,这限制了DApp在高频交易场景下的应用。
- 跨链交互的复杂性:随着多链生态的发展,跨链交互日益频繁,但不同链之间的连接稳定性、跨链桥的安全性等问题,也增加了开发的复杂性和不确定性。
这些连接不稳定的问题,迫使开发者将大量资源用于优化连接、处理异常和容错机制,而非专注于核心功能的创新,这在一定程度上拖慢了Web3技术迭代和应用落地的步伐。
生态发展的“瓶颈”:去中心化理想的现实挑战
Web3的核心精神之一是去中心化,旨在消除单点故障,构建一个更加鲁棒和抗审查的系统,当前连接不稳定的现状,却在某种程度上与这一理想背道而驰。
- 中心化节点的隐忧:尽管许多公链宣称去中心化,但实际运行中,少数几个大型节点服务商可能占据了大部分的节点市场份额,形成了新的“中心化”风险,一旦这些节点出现问题,将导致大面积的服务中断。
